Twitter API ответ на твит - PullRequest
       1

Twitter API ответ на твит

0 голосов
/ 17 февраля 2019

Я пытаюсь написать скрипт для ответа на твит, используя модуль twit npm.Однако всякий раз, когда я передаю in_reply_to_status_id_str или in_reply_to_status_id, это, кажется, игнорируется.Не уверены, в чем проблема?

   T.get('search/tweets', { q: `golf since:2011-07-11`, count: 1 }).then(function (response) {

            const userName = response.data.statuses[0].user.screen_name;
            const tweetId = response.data.statuses[0].id_str;

            T.post('statuses/update', { in_reply_to_status_id_str: tweetId, status: `@${userName}, I like golf too` }, (err, data, response) => {
              resolve()
            })
          })

        })

1 Ответ

0 голосов
/ 12 марта 2019

Вы должны передавать параметр как in_reply_to_status_id вместо in_reply_to_status_id_str.

T.get('search/tweets', { q: `golf since:2011-07-11`, count: 1 }).then(function (response) {

            const userName = response.data.statuses[0].user.screen_name;
            const tweetId = response.data.statuses[0].id_str;

            T.post('statuses/update', { in_reply_to_status_id: tweetId, status: `@${userName}, I like golf too` }, (err, data, response) => {
              resolve()
            })
          })

        })
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...